WFDF Virtual Sport World Team Disc Golf Championship Finals this Weekend

In News, Press Release * Official Communication by WFDF


The inaugural World Flying Disc Federation (WFDF) 2022 Virtual Sport World Team Disc Golf Championship (VSWTDGC), hosted by Disc Golf Valley and in Partnership with Latitude 64 and Spinoff Games, enters the final rounds this weekend, with 19 countries having qualified for the mixed pair competition.

For the Finals, National mixed-gender teams will be made up of two players representing each country, composed of the highest-ranked male and female per country in the qualifying rounds over the last four weeks. Countries represented are: Canada, Czech Republic, Denmark, Estonia, Finland, France, Germany, Great Britain, Iceland, Latvia, Lithuania, Malaysia, Netherlands, New Zealand, Poland, Portugal, Sweden, Switzerland, and the USA. Teams from four other countries – Australia, Hungary, Italy, and Norway – could have qualified but failed to register a complete pair for the finals.

“We are looking forward to the final rounds of WFDF’s first Virtual Disc Golf Championships this weekend. We were pleased to have 3,263 participants from 39 countries compete in this inaugural event,” stated WFDF President Robert “Nob” Rauch. “We look forward to an exciting weekend of play to crown our first champions!”

The finals will open at midnight on Friday night February 18th Central European Time (CET) and will close at midnight Sunday 20th CET. To crown the Virtual Sport World Team Disc Golf World Champion, the finals this weekend will combine team scores over three rounds with the lowest overall score taking first prize. All players have the same virtual flying discs available and will play the same three courses, Grizzly Gulch, Kaho Park, and Pioneer Bay. Only teams that complete a score for all 6 rounds (3 courses x male and female) will be eligible for the leaderboard. Players are responsible to to log their results prior to midnight CET on Sunday the 20th of February. WFDF will announce the official results via press release on Monday the 21st of February 2022.
